8,715,322 is a composite number, even.

This number doesn't have a permanent NumberWiki page yet — what you see below is computed live. Pages get added to the permanent index when they're notable (years, primes, curated, etc.).

8,715,322 (eight million seven hundred fifteen thousand three hundred twenty-two)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 32 divisors, and factors as 2 × 7 × 11 × 17 × 3,329.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x84FC3A.
